Mark 8:14

King James Version 1611 (Original)

Now the disciples had forgotten to take bread, neither had they in the ship with them more than one loaf.

  • Matt 16:5-12
    8 verses
    89%

    5And when his disciples were come to the other side, they had forgotten to take bread.

    6Then Jesus said unto them, Take heed and beware of the leaven of the Pharisees and of the Sadducees.

    7And they reasoned among themselves, saying, It is because we have taken no bread.

    8Which when Jesus perceived, he said unto them, O ye of little faith, why reason ye among yourselves, because ye have brought no bread?

    9Do ye not yet understand, neither remember the five loaves of the five thousand, and how many baskets ye took up?

    10Neither the seven loaves of the four thousand, and how many baskets ye took up?

    11How is it that ye do not understand that I spake it not to you concerning bread, that ye should beware of the leaven of the Pharisees and of the Sadducees?

    12Then understood they how that he bade them not beware of the leaven of bread, but of the doctrine of the Pharisees and of the Sadducees.

  • Mark 8:15-20
    6 verses
    79%

    15And he charged them, saying, Take heed, beware of the leaven of the Pharisees, and of the leaven of Herod.

    16And they reasoned among themselves, saying, It is because we have no bread.

    17And when Jesus knew it, he saith unto them, Why reason ye, because ye have no bread? perceive ye not yet, neither understand? have ye your heart yet hardened?

    18Having eyes, see ye not? and having ears, hear ye not? and do ye not remember?

    19When I brake the five loaves among five thousand, how many baskets full of fragments took ye up? They say unto him, Twelve.

    20And when the seven among four thousand, how many baskets full of fragments took ye up? And they said, Seven.
